Democrats should replace Debbie Wasserman Schultz as chair of the Democratic National Committee because she has used the DNC to help Hillary Clinton's campaign for president, hurt Bernie Sanders' campaign for president, and insulted the liberal wing of the party by trying to prevent large numbers of voters from watching the Democratic presidential debates.
Ms. Wasserman Schultz is doing something no party chair should do, which is taking sides in a presidential campaign, and she is not doing what every party chair should do, which is building the party by registering voters and strengthening the Democratic grassroots organization in ways that help all candidates for president, Congress and governors.
Any high school student taking civics could figure out Ms. Wasserman Schultz and the DNC organized the presidential debates in ways that were deliberately designed to minimize the national audience and thereby help Ms. Clinton defeat any progressive insurgent candidate.
